Hi All -

I've looked at this site a few tims over the years. I'm just starting a new cycle and so I'm not.....very happy.

I started CH's about 20 years ago, in my early 30's. I'm now 52. Initially they were 4'snand 5's withthe ocasional 6 or 7. They were chronic. That lasted for maybe 5 years. Then they became sort-of episodic, with 2 - 4 weeks of every now and them - but they started getting worse, with maxes of 8 or so.
Eventually they got diagnosed (no drugs helped save getting something cold and that not much) and then they've settled into a reasonably regular pattern: 5 - 6 months on, 18 - 19 months off.
I've been looking forwards to August this year for 18 months and I've not been disappointed: 7th Aug 0030 I woke up and thought 'Yep,they're back.'.
I expect that over the next 5 - 6 months they will get worseand worse and worse, and then tail off rapidly. I'm not looking forward to any of it, but I expect to survive although there will be moments when I won't want to.
I'm lucky in that 95+% of attacks ocur at night - on my time - so myjob is not threatened. I just have to get through the days when I'm
tired..

Still, the idea of the pain in the next six months is not enticing.

I should say that I find drinking White wine is as good a preventative and ameliorator as I've found: white wine is a vaso-constrictor as opposed to red which is a vaso-dilator. Seems to work for me, a bit anyway.

My sister has MS which is pretty painful, so I don't want to complain to much;  I just though I'd share my dread of the next few months and cheeryou all up!
